CrAfter School: Mini Clay Creations Part Deux
Kids in grades 3-5 can come to the Library and make miniature sculptures out of air-drying clay!

The Old Lyme-Phoebe Griffin Noyes Library will hold CrAfter School on Monday, October 6, 2014 from 3:30-4:30PM. You asked and we listened! We’re bringing clay back. Mold, sculpt, and smooth your colorful creation on a piece of wax paper. Then, take it home, let it set for 24 hours and you’re done. This project won’t be messy since we will use air drying clay, but it will be a lot of fun! We will meet in the Children’s Room this time.
